kernel: update z_arch_switch() documentation
Clarify the intended design and how to implement optimally. Relates to: #19759 Signed-off-by: Andrew Boie <andrew.p.boie@intel.com>

* 1) Push all thread state relevant to the context switch to the current stack
|
||||||
|
* 2) Update the switched_from parameter to contain the current stack pointer,
|
||||||
|
* after all context has been saved. switched_from is used as an output-
|
||||||
|
* only parameter and its current value is ignored (and can be NULL, see
|
||||||
|
* below).
|
||||||
|
* 3) Set the stack pointer to the value provided in switch_to
|
||||||
|
* 4) Pop off all thread state from the stack we switched to and return.
|
||||||
|
*
|
||||||
|
* Some arches may implement thread->switch handle as a pointer to the thread
|
||||||
|
* itself, and save context somewhere in thread->arch. In this case, on initial
|
||||||
|
* context switch from the dummy thread, thread->switch handle for the outgoing
|
||||||
|
* thread is NULL. Instead of dereferencing switched_from all the way to get
|
||||||
|
* the thread pointer, subtract ___thread_t_switch_handle_OFFSET to obtain the
|
||||||
|
* thread pointer instead.
